Job summary

A local government authority in the UK is seeking a Senior Service Improvement Officer to lead transformational change within their Asset Management team. This role focuses on improving lives through effective management of housing assets, ensuring compliance and safety, and engaging with tenants. The ideal candidate will possess strong project management skills and an understanding of social housing best practices. The council is committed to professional growth and will support skill development for the right candidate.

Qualifications

  • Understanding of social housing best practices, particularly tenant safety and compliance.
  • Proven project management experience, with ability to plan, prioritise, and meet deadlines.
  • Strong communication skills, with ability to provide practical solutions.
  • Demonstrated leadership in driving change and managing workloads effectively.

Responsibilities

  • Leading on change to enhance management of housing assets.
  • Supporting implementation of innovative practices for housing strategy goals.
  • Ensuring integrity of asset compliance data and reporting.
  • Engaging with tenants and leaseholders for effective communication.
